Bonus details – wagering requirements and betting options
The welcome bonus comes with a 5x wagering requirement on the bonus amount only. That means if you receive a $100 match bonus, you need to place $500 worth of qualifying bets before you can cash out. Qualifying bets include most sports markets, but some high‑variance events such as multi‑bet accumulators may be excluded.
On the casino side, the bonus can be used on slots, table games and live dealer tables. The free sports bets are limited to selected pre‑match markets like AFL, NRL, and major international football leagues. Payment methods, deposits and withdrawal speed
Australian players have a good selection of deposit methods, from credit cards to modern e‑wallets. Below is a quick comparison of the most common options.
| Method | Min Deposit | Processing Time | Fees |
|---|---|---|---|
| Visa / Mastercard | $20 | Instant | None |
| PayPal | $30 | Instant | None |
| POLi | $10 | Instant | None |
| Bank Transfer | $50 | 1–2 business days | Variable |
Withdrawals are processed on a “next‑day” basis for most e‑wallets, while bank transfers can take up to three business days. Pointsbet aims for instant payouts on approved accounts, but they will always run a KYC check before the first withdrawal.
